Cotton
Cotton is one of the most widely used fabrics for shirts and pants due to its comfort, breathability, and durability. There are several types of cotton fabrics, each offering different properties:
- Regular Cotton:Known for its softness and breathability, regular cotton is ideal for casual wear.
- Pique Cotton:A medium-weight cotton with a unique ribbed texture, often used for sportswear and formal shirts.
- Linen:Made from flax fibers, linen is highly breathable and perfect for warm climates. It has a natural, relaxed drape and is known for its durability.
Silk
Silk is a luxurious fabric prized for its smooth texture, sheen, and elegance. It is commonly used for high-end shirts and pants, especially those intended for formal occasions.
- Silk Blends:Combining silk with other fibers like cotton or rayon can enhance durability and reduce cost while maintaining a luxurious feel.
- Silk Chiffon:A lightweight and sheer silk fabric, perfect for summer shirts and dresses.
Wool
Wool is a versatile fabric known for its warmth, durability, and natural moisture-wicking properties. It is ideal for both formal and casual wear, especially in cooler climates.
- Merino Wool:A fine and soft wool derived from Merino sheep, offering superior comfort and breathability.
- Cashmere:Known for its exceptional softness and warmth, cashmere is a premium fabric often used for luxury pants and suits.
Nylon and Polyester
Nylon and polyester are synthetic fabrics that offer durability, ease of care, and a wide range of textures. They are commonly used in blends to enhance the properties of natural fabrics.
- Nylon Blends:Often combined with cotton to improve durability and stretch, making shirts and pants more comfortable.
- Polyester:Known for its wrinkle resistance and quick-drying properties, polyester is a popular choice for sportswear and casual pants.

How to Care for Your Shirt and Pant Fabrics
Proper care is essential to maintain the quality and longevity of your shirts and pants. Below are some tips for caring for different types of fabrics.
Cotton Care
- Washing:Use cold water and a gentle cycle to avoid shrinkage.
- Drying:Air dry or tumble dry on low heat to prevent damage.
- Ironing:Iron on a medium setting to remove wrinkles without damaging the fabric.
Silk Care
- Washing:Hand wash in cold water with a mild detergent.
- Drying:Lay flat to dry to avoid stretching.
- Ironing:Iron on a low setting or use a silk ironing press.
Wool Care
- Washing:Hand wash in cold water with a wool-specific detergent.
- Drying:Lay flat to dry away from direct sunlight.
- Ironing:Iron on a low setting or use steam to remove wrinkles.
